Transaction 118ba2fd7fe144a11e136a7537e0f2b962df9ce4396c049ac946550b4573db0b

1 Input
2 Outputs
  • 118ba2fd7fe144a11e136a7537e0f2b962df9ce4396c049ac946550b4573db0b:0
  • value  44161541712
    address  33fxBPckhQT5WDWuXJXGceDHZe9r6u3CDq
  • 118ba2fd7fe144a11e136a7537e0f2b962df9ce4396c049ac946550b4573db0b:1
  • value  5259333666
    address  3BMEXvRZp5UTrfiLp1tgTHyf4DManUFxbU